Books

My 2021 book Eve is a heavy book in more than one sense. It is a 220 page exploration of love, friendship, family, the natural environment and the end of the world. I worked hard on creating a gorgeous print that reflects Yorkshire colours, also it has a map inside the front cover based on…

Cree

Cree (Mayfly Press, 2018) is set in Stanley, a small town in a beautiful rural area just outside the city of Durham. Much of this part of the north east went into decline after the closure of the British Steel plant in Consett in 1980 and the closure of coal mines in the area after…
